May 2008 - The body stripped, I trucked it to an experienced metal fabricator: GTA Auto Body in Orange, California - It is the same shop that did the repairs on my S600 Roadster.

With their expertise they skillfully removed the dents and dings in the body and repaired a little rust in the front rockers.  The most significant damage was the roof.  They used a heating technique to "iron out" the damaged metal and then physically hammered out the remaining wrinkles.

I was amazed that they were able to straighten the roof as it was pretty mangled.  Just goes to show there is no substitute for experience!

The paint shop applied a skim coat and sanded the car smooth in preparation for the color.

The front of the car was the other major problem area.  The nose, grill, hood, the front fenders, front apron and bumper all needed attention.

The final prep of the body is critical before the paint is applied.  The Coupe's body is shown here just before it is sprayed. 

Gary at GTA straightened things up front so the abuse was only a memory. Edit

June 2008 the paint is complete!  The car is a great, original shade of Honda R-2 otherwise know as Scarlet.  It is strange to see the body straight and the finish gleaming.  After a little color sanding it will be time to reassemble!
